USB (Universal Serial Bus) is an interface which has been developed for simple connection of mouse devices, keyboards, joysticks and printers with the computer. Most of these devices do not require an external power supply, because the USB port supplies up to 500mA and 5V per connection.
You can use a USB cable to connect things like your smartphone, your navigation device, your iPad or your iPod with the computer to update them, but also to recharge them.
